kajoiner Posted April 28, 2004 Posted April 28, 2004 (edited) My wife is having an unusual problem in that she is getting her web site linked to some websites where we do not want the link posted. She hosts a website for some dolls that she makes and the name she has given her dolls are "Prissy May Dolls". In looking at the awstats, it appears that there are several I AM A SPAMMER sites that have added her site to there links page. There are several (about 50) click throughs from websites like x******* and n*******. Does it hurt her standing with search engines when she is listed on sites like these? Is there any way to prevent them from linking to her site? I don't think we want the link listed there regardless! TCH-Rob Posted April 28, 2004 Posted April 28, 2004 No, you can not prevent a link. The good news is that it will not hurt you either. If it did, think of the damage you could do to competing sites by having bad links to their site. From Google; There is almost nothing a competitor can do to harm your ranking or have your site removed from our index. Your rank and your inclusion are dependent on factors under your control as a webmaster, including content choices and site design. Quote

Deverill Posted April 28, 2004 Posted April 28, 2004 You could try asking them to remove it but they probably won't. As Rob said, they can't hurt you in the Search Engines and, as a matter of fact, may inadvertently help you slightly. Google uses page rank. If the page the link is on has a high page rank it will transfer, in part, to your site because of the "vote of confidence." Since the sites are so different it may not be a huge bump but it may be a slight one. I understand how you would want them to stop but there really is no way to do it other than if they agree to a request from you to remove it unless you want to go into the realm of high priced lawyers and defamation of character stuff.
